About this listen
Built in 1787 for Reverend Dr. William White, this home was filled with faith, friendship… and, as it turns out, future ghost stories. In this episode, we explore the spirits that linger within these historic walls. From the family cook to ghostly pets and the owner of the house himself, the spirits here are a quite the cast of characters. Why do these spirits remain? What ties them to this sacred space? And what does it say when even a bishop might not rest in peace? Tune in for a historic and haunting look into one of Philadelphia’s most ghost-filled landmarks.
